What is a food web?
A connecting system of multiple food chains.
How much energy is lost from trophic level to trophic level?
Close to 90% of the energy that was there is lost.
If an animal has 100,000 kcals how much energy is passed on?
Approximately 10,000
Which way does the energy flow in the food chain?
Producer to primary consumer to secondary consumer etc.

Where does the energy in a plant come from?
The sun
Which way does energy flow in a food web?
From low to high trophic levels
Why are there usually only four trophic levels?
Because so much energy is lost at each level.
